Hi, all
I've build a model in ansoft Q3D,when the simulation is finished,I right click Analysis to export the equivalent circuit, the format of the file is *.cir.
The problem is I don't know how to use this *.cir file in ansoft designer or other softwares,so I can see how the quilvalent circuit is and do some comparison with the results of HFSS.
i think the .cir is a spice format , which is a spice netlist file . so u can open the .cir file with a wordpad or any text editor , and then draw the circuit on the designer

you can use the *.cir file un PSPICE of cadence, it is a netlist, it is just the subcircuit containing tha SPICE equivelent circuit of your model. but in Q3D you can also change the the export file to other extentios, if I remember well you can exporto to RLC circuit model, and some others. what do you need the circuit for? to compare the results with HFSS? in HFSS you can also export the circuit and use SPICE to simulate. hope this helps.
